I have a 99GT, and I am having both of those problems. I know it doesnt sound glamourous, but I pulled my dash out, took off the contact screws where the spedo screws into the contact mat, and added a bit of contact cleaner. Also check for anything that is loose, wires etc.. Mine had something barely hanging on, I taped that up, and put it back. Worked pretty well for me. As far as the transmission, well if you dont have a 5 spd, you may consider saving up for when it drops.
